Athletics vs Cardinals Game Thread
Sears hopes to pave the way back to the win column
The St. Louis Cardinals visit the Oakland Athletics today at the Coliseum for the second game of the interleague three-game set. The A’s dropped the opener 3-1, with Ross Stripling falling to 0-4. The A’s hope that lefty JP Sears will keep the momentum going after a great win last Thursday against the reigning World Series Champion Texas Rangers. Sears tossed six + shutout innings in that matchup, his best outing of the young 2024 season. Sears will face 31-year-old Lance Lynn for the Cards. Lynn seems to have regained his form after a rocky 2023 season split between the White Sox and Dodgers. This will be his fourth start of the season.

Rest in Peace: Whitey Herzog
The Cardinals lost a legend today when former Manager Whitey Herzog passed away. He managed the Cardinals for parts of 11 seasons from 1980-90, leading the team to three National League pennants and the 1982 World Series title. ‘Whiteyball’, as it came to be known in St. Louis, placed an emphasis on strong pitching and defense, speed on the basepaths, and contact hitting. He was inducted into the MLB Hall of Fame in 2010 and the Cardinals Hall of Fame in 2014. Herzog played for the Kansas City Athletics briefly from 1958 to 1960.
